Irish Boxty

Boxty is a traditional Irish dish made of potatoes. An old Irish rhyme goes: "Boxty on the griddle, boxty on the pan; if you can't make boxty, you'll never get a man."

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Toss grated potatoes with flour in a large bowl. Stir in mashed potatoes until combined.
Step 2
In a separate bowl, whisk together egg and milk; mix into the potatoes.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
Step 3
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Drop in the potato mixture, forming patties about 2 inches in diameter. Fry on both sides until golden brown, 3 to 4 minutes per side. Drain on a paper towel-lined plate. Serve warm.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 large egg
  • ¼ cup olive oil
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on skim milk
  • 1 cup leftover mashed potatoes
  • 1 ½ cups grated raw potatoes
